Popular Welding Certifications

While the American Welding Society’s standard CW credential opens the door for the majority of job opportunities, a number of industries require a specialized certification. Several of the most-well-known of them appear below.

  • American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for those who focus on boiler and pressure vessels
  • CW Certification to be a Certified Welder
  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for those who work with pipelines in the energy industry
  • CWI and SCWI Certification for inspectors and senior inspectors

Precisely What is Included in Your welder Training Program?

So, have you gotten to the place where you are ready to pick which welding schools fit your needs? Choosing welder schools may perhaps seem very simple, however you have to be sure that you’re picking the best style of training. For starters, find out if the welding specialist program is approved or certified with the AWS. A number of other areas you may wish to consider apart from the accreditation issue include:

  • Ensure that the college’s curriculum features training in pipe welding, GTAW, GMAW, and SMAW
  • Look for institutions that comply with AWS SENSE standards
  • See if the program provides financial assistance
  • Make certain the program teaches on tools that meets up-to-date industry requirements
